[Résolu] Liste des utilisateurs

Installation & Configuration du logiciel
Répondre
damienvidal
Gsup LEVEL 0
Messages : 5
Enregistré le : mer. 14 nov. 2018 09:27
Localisation : Béziers

Bonjour,
Je viens de faire la mise à jour vers la dernière stable, à savoir la v3.1.34 et la liste des utilisateurs est vide alors qu'en base, ils y sont bien tous.
Ils proviennent d'une synchronisation LDAP.
Dans l'attente,
Cordialement,
Technicien Informatique à l'Agglomération Béziers Méditerranée (Hérault)
--
Version de GestSup 3.1.34
OS : CentOs - BDD : MySQL - PHP : v5.6.20
Avatar du membre
Flox
Administrateur du site
Messages : 9404
Enregistré le : jeu. 21 juin 2012 19:00

Bonjour,

pouvez vous regarder en base si sur ces utilisateur la colonne "disable" n'est pas positionnée à 1 ?

Cdt
GestSup: 3.2.47 | Debian: 12 | Apache: 2.4.59 | MariaDB: 11.5.2 | PHP: 8.3.12 | https://doc.gestsup.fr/
damienvidal
Gsup LEVEL 0
Messages : 5
Enregistré le : mer. 14 nov. 2018 09:27
Localisation : Béziers

Bonjour,
Non, c'est sur le 0.
Cdt,
Technicien Informatique à l'Agglomération Béziers Méditerranée (Hérault)
--
Version de GestSup 3.1.34
OS : CentOs - BDD : MySQL - PHP : v5.6.20
Avatar du membre
Flox
Administrateur du site
Messages : 9404
Enregistré le : jeu. 21 juin 2012 19:00

pouvez vous activer le mode debug pour voir si une erreur apparaît ?
GestSup: 3.2.47 | Debian: 12 | Apache: 2.4.59 | MariaDB: 11.5.2 | PHP: 8.3.12 | https://doc.gestsup.fr/
damienvidal
Gsup LEVEL 0
Messages : 5
Enregistré le : mer. 14 nov. 2018 09:27
Localisation : Béziers

Voici

Code : Tout sélectionner

SELECT distinct tusers.* FROM tusers LEFT OUTER JOIN tusers_services ON tusers_services.user_id=tusers.id LEFT OUTER JOIN tservices ON tservices.id=tusers_services.service_id WHERE profile LIKE :profile AND tusers.id!=:id AND tusers.disable=:disable AND ( tusers.lastname LIKE :lastname OR tusers.firstname LIKE :firstname OR tusers.mail LIKE :mail OR tusers.phone LIKE :phone OR tusers.mobile LIKE :mobile OR tusers.login LIKE :login OR tservices.name LIKE :service_name ) ORDER BY lastname,firstname ASC LIMIT 0,15
Fatal error: Uncaught exception 'PDOException' with message 'SQLSTATE[42S22]: Column not found: 1054 Unknown column 'tusers.mobile' in 'where clause'' in /var/www/html/services/commandepublique/admin/user.php:1791 Stack trace: #0 /var/www/html/services/commandepublique/admin/user.php(1791): PDOStatement->execute(Array) #1 /var/www/html/services/commandepublique/admin.php(24): include('/var/www/html/s...') #2 /var/www/html/services/commandepublique/index.php(900): include('/var/www/html/s...') #3 {main} thrown in /var/www/html/services/commandepublique/admin/user.php on line 1791
Technicien Informatique à l'Agglomération Béziers Méditerranée (Hérault)
--
Version de GestSup 3.1.34
OS : CentOs - BDD : MySQL - PHP : v5.6.20
Avatar du membre
Flox
Administrateur du site
Messages : 9404
Enregistré le : jeu. 21 juin 2012 19:00

Bonjour,

j'ai l'impression que la mise à jour SQL : ./_SQL/update_3.1.30_to_3.1.31.sql n'a pas été correctement exécuté sur votre serveur.

Je vous invite à vérifier en base de donnée si sur la table "tusers" vous avez une colonne nommé "mobile", si ce n'est pas le cas je vous invite à reprendre les procédure d'installation des mise à jour depuis la section documentation.
GestSup: 3.2.47 | Debian: 12 | Apache: 2.4.59 | MariaDB: 11.5.2 | PHP: 8.3.12 | https://doc.gestsup.fr/
damienvidal
Gsup LEVEL 0
Messages : 5
Enregistré le : mer. 14 nov. 2018 09:27
Localisation : Béziers

Super!
Merci pour l'aide :D
PS : je mets "résolu"
Technicien Informatique à l'Agglomération Béziers Méditerranée (Hérault)
--
Version de GestSup 3.1.34
OS : CentOs - BDD : MySQL - PHP : v5.6.20
Avatar du membre
Flox
Administrateur du site
Messages : 9404
Enregistré le : jeu. 21 juin 2012 19:00

Très bien, je vous invite également à vérifier que tous les autres patch SQL ont bien été appliqués.

Cdt
GestSup: 3.2.47 | Debian: 12 | Apache: 2.4.59 | MariaDB: 11.5.2 | PHP: 8.3.12 | https://doc.gestsup.fr/
Répondre